RabbitMQ 典型应用场景实战

RabbitMQ 作为目前应用相当广泛的消息中间件,在企业级应用、微服务应用中充当着重要的角色。特别是在一些典型的应用场景以及业务模块中具有重要的作用,比如业务服务模块解耦,异步通信,高并发限流,超时延迟处理等均有广泛的应用!

本场 Chat 我将开始从官网的权威开发手册简要的介绍 RabbitMQ,然后将以 SpringBoot 为奠基将 RabbitMQ 实战应用到各种业务场景中。主要内容包括:

  1. RabbitMQ 的概要简介、相关组件介绍以及Spring的事件驱动模型分享。
  2. SpringBoot 整合 RabbitMQ 配置介绍以及发送接受消息方式实战。
  3. SpringBoot 整合 RabbitMQ 实战业务模块解耦以及异步通信(包括异步写日志,异步发送邮件)。
  4. RabbitMQ 并发消费配置以及消息确认机制实战(实战场景为:用户商城下单)。
  5. 死信队列 DLX、DLK、TTL 认识与实战(实战场景为:用户下单并在指定时间未支付时自动失效实战)。

阅读全文: http://gitbook.cn/gitchat/activity/5b90f9214fb1bd5c9acd4338

一场场看太麻烦?订阅GitChat体验卡,畅享300场chat文章!更有CSDN下载、CSDN学院等超划算会员权益!点击查看

猜你喜欢

转载自blog.csdn.net/valada/article/details/82469948